How do you find average speed from Maxwell-Boltzmann distribution?

The average speed of molecules can be calculated as an integral of the Maxwell-Boltzmann distribution function multiplied by the magnitude of velocity of a molecule v. The variable of integration, velocity, can attain all possible values, therefore we integrate from zero to infinity.

What does Boltzmann distribution tell us?

The Boltzmann distribution gives the probability that a system will be in a certain state as a function of that state’s energy, while the Maxwell-Boltzmann distributions give the probabilities of particle speeds or energies in ideal gases.

What is the most probable speed in the Maxwellian distribution law in molecular velocities?

The speed at the top of the curve is called the most probable speed because the largest number of molecules have that speed. Figure 1: The Maxwell-Boltzmann distribution is shifted to higher speeds and is broadened at higher temperatures.

What do you mean by average speed?

Average speed is calculated by dividing the total distance that something has traveled by the total amount of time it took it to travel that distance. Speed is how fast something is going at a particular moment. Average speed measures the average rate of speed over the extent of a trip.
